Transaction 19efb34d6d17f8173ec3977a72298b54881c48cd137598341de24961fc73e906
2 Input
2 Outputs
- 19efb34d6d17f8173ec3977a72298b54881c48cd137598341de24961fc73e906:0
- 19efb34d6d17f8173ec3977a72298b54881c48cd137598341de24961fc73e906:1
value 46473
address 1GQSZYcSWnKRMoDDFUnRgQGLDvDdos7Zfq
value 648184
address 35FxQ2DnkSbMTR2EeJNwF3gHMMVf4tdp6G